Hints for Experiencing a Las Vegas Getaway
People associate many numerous things with a Vegas getaway. Some folks do picture a booze and betting-abundant affair, while some do see a nice getaway away from abode with the kids when they envision about a junket to Sin City. In the late 60s and early 70s, the Vegas getaway business certainly flourished. This is largely because of the efforts to recreate the appearance of Las Vegas into a playground for adults.
The Sin City of that time was awash of glitzy gambling halls, boundless shows, and lounges that were open night and day. You could catch an event, gamble all evening, down a drink with breakfast, bed down for a number of hours before doing it all over again in a Las Vegas holiday amid those times.
The character of a Las Vegas holiday became something absolutely different in the early 90. Sin City gambling halls started to appeal to families who were traveling altogether with the introduction of attractions like New York New York’s roller coaster and MGM Grand’s child friendly environment.
Gambling den administrators recognized they can lure the all-night gamblers and big spenders while catering to an absolutely new patrons, the families, who brought their own money to play in the Sin City sands. As an outcome, kid accommodating entertainment, eatery’s, and attractions began to abound. Many gambling dens also presented bambino entertainment areas so mom and dad possibly could still go over to drink and wager.
The current Las Vegas vacation is an abnormal combination between the adult and kid’s playground. Guests can now behold roller coasters rumble above gambling den floors where slots ting and whiz and roulette wheels spin. These days, leaflets for escort businesses clutter the alley and announcements for topless entertainment are shown on taxicabs near to advertisements for Sponge Bob Square Pants because of the authorization of harlotry in Vegas.
